The Lincoln Leopards will head out on the road to square off against the Solomon Gorillas on Friday. Having both just faced considerable losses, both teams are looking to turn things around.
It's never fun to lose, and it's even less fun to lose 58-19, which was the final score in Lincoln's tilt against Thunder Ridge on Tuesday.
Meanwhile, Solomon was the victim of a rough 53-33 loss at the hands of Herington on Tuesday. Solomon has now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Lincoln's loss dropped their record down to 6-11. As for Solomon, they dropped their record down to 3-16 with that loss, which was their tenth straight at home.
Lincoln strolled past Solomon in their previous matchup back in February of 2023 by a score of 45-29. The rematch might be a little tougher for Lincoln since the team won't have the home-court adv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
